What Is Fiveminutes.biz?

Fiveminutes.biz is a dubious website which tries to trick users into subscribing to its notifications service. Site notifications are messages from sites that appear in the lower right corner of the screen on Windows computers, in the top right corner on Macbooks, and on the status bar on mobile devices. Fiveminutes.biz claims that users need to click Allow on its “Show notifications” pop-up if they wish to access a page, download a file, watch a video, solve a CAPTCHA, etc. Should a user click Allow, notifications from Fiveminutes.biz will begin appearing on the screen periodically and spamming the user with ads, clickbait links, software offers, fake alerts, and so on.
